admin 管理员组文章数量: 1184232
2024年4月29日发(作者:constant词源)
通讯录管理系统项目可行性分析
概述
通讯录管理系统作为一个小型的信息系统项目,主要目的
是帮助用户集中管理通讯录信息,方便用户查询、维护及分享
联系人信息。本文将对该项目进行可行性分析,并对可能遇到
的问题和解决方案进行探讨。
市场分析
通讯录管理系统开发的目的是服务用户,因此首先要考虑
的是市场需求。当前,随着社交媒体、通信技术的迅猛发展,
用户每天处理的信息量越来越大,通讯录的管理也变得越来越
复杂。同时,不同的用户还需要适用于不同终端的通讯录应用,
如智能手机、电脑等。因此,开发一个通用、易用的通讯录管
理系统符合当前市场需求。
项目开发分析
项目的开发涉及多个方面,包括系统架构设计、数据库设
计、系统功能设计、应用程序开发等。在进行项目开发之前,
必须要进行可行性分析。可行性分析包括以下几个方面:
1. 技术可行性分析:该项目需要使用到的技术包括前端
技术(HTML、CSS、JavaScript等)、后端技术(PHP、Java等)、
数据库技术(MySQL、Oracle等)等。技术上的可行性在于开
发人员是否具备相关技术能力,并且这些技术是否能够实现该
项目的要求。
2. 经济可行性分析:该项目的开发需要投入一定的资金
和人力,因此需要对项目的经济可行性进行分析。在开发初期
需要编写详细的开发计划,并估算出开发成本和预期收益,分
析是否值得开发。
3. 时间可行性分析:该项目的开发需要一定的时间,需
要合理安排时间表,避免在开发过程中时间紧迫,导致开发质
量降低。
4. 环境可行性分析:开发需要考虑使用哪种开发环境,
如开发操作系统、Web服务器、数据库环境等问题,以确保
项目能够达到预期的目标。
开发人员必须对以上四个方面进行合理的分析和评估,在
评估出项目可行之后再开始开发。
问题与解决方案分析
在开发过程中可能会遇到各种问题,需要及时进行解决。
以下是一些可能遇到的问题及解决方案:
1. 数据库性能问题:随着数据量的增加,数据库的查询
效率会越来越低。解决方法是使用合适的数据库技术和优化数
据库设计。
2. 安全问题:用户的个人信息涉及到隐私保护,需要采
用合适的加密技术保证安全。同时,系统还需要进行常规的安
全检查和升级。
3. 移动端兼容性问题:用户使用的终端多种多样,需要
充分考虑各种设备的兼容性和适配问题,采用响应式设计和设
备特性检测等技术,确保应用在各种终端上都能够正常运行和
体验良好。
4. 业务流程设计问题:系统的业务流程需要符合用户习
惯以及用户的需求,需要在开发前就进行详细的业务流程设计,
避免工作中出现的不必要的瑕疵和影响。
总结
通讯录管理系统作为一种小型的信息系统项目,主要服务
于用户,帮助用户集中管理通讯录信息。在项目开发中需要进
行可行性分析,解决可能遇到的问题,确保系统的高效性、可
靠性和可扩展性。同时,开发过程中需要充分考虑用户习惯和
开发成本等因素,以满足用户的需求和经济利益。
版权声明:本文标题:通讯录管理系统项目可行性分析 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1714404916a678704.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论